How does Mineola, IA compare to Palmer, IA? Mineola has a population of 115 with a median household income of $99,375, while Palmer has 114 residents and a median income of $60,625.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Mineola, IA | Palmer, IA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 115 | 114 | +0.9% |
| Median Age | 14.4 | 52.8 | -72.7% |
| Foreign Born % | 0% | 1.8% | -100.0% |
| Metric | Mineola | Palmer |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$99,375 | $60,625 | +63.9% |
| Unemployment | 0% | 3.6% | -100.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 6.1% | 31.6% | -80.7% |
| Bachelor's+ | 49% | 12% | +308.3% |
